Xbox 360 and PS3 Failures Explained – 40% of dead consoles are PS3’s

By Geoffrey Tim
September 1, 2009
in :  Gaming
31

Eurogamer’s Digital Foundry has, through the help of a rather busy console repair shop, examined the failures that have plagued Microsoft’s Xbox 360, and more recently, Sony’s PlayStation 3. While the internet as a whole is well aware of the 360’s hardware problems, people are becoming increasingly aware of hardware reliability issues with the PS3. According to the repair outlet’s …

No Xbox 360 "Slim" Says Microsoft

By Nick De Bruyne
August 28, 2009
in :  Gaming
1

Microsoft’s Aaron Greenberg has told Kotaku that there are no plans for a “slim” version of the Xbox 360 and that they are barely even at the halfway point of the systems life. Greenberg says that “People have invested in these consoles, and we have massively connected communities and we have storage. I think what we did with the New …
